    Implantable Cardiac Monitors Market Summary

    As per MRFR analysis, the Implantable Cardiac Monitors Market Size was estimated at 0.7 USD Billion in 2024. The Implantable Cardiac Monitors industry is projected to grow from 0.749 in 2025 to 1.474 by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7.0 during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

    Key Market Trends & Highlights

    The Implantable Cardiac Monitors Market is poised for substantial growth driven by technological advancements and an increasing focus on preventive healthcare.

    • North America remains the largest market for implantable cardiac monitors, driven by advanced healthcare infrastructure and high patient awareness.
    • The Asia-Pacific region is emerging as the fastest-growing market, fueled by rising healthcare investments and a growing aging population.
    • Atrial fibrillation continues to dominate the market segment, while cardiac arrhythmias are recognized as the fastest-growing segment due to increasing diagnosis rates.
    • Technological advancements and a heightened focus on preventive healthcare are key drivers propelling market growth, alongside rising cardiovascular disease prevalence.

    Market Size & Forecast

    2024 Market Size 0.7 (USD Billion)
    2035 Market Size 1.474 (USD Billion)
    CAGR (2025 - 2035) 7.0%

    Major Players

    Medtronic (US), Abbott (US), Boston Scientific (US), Biotronik (DE), Sorin Group (IT), St. Jude Medical (US), Cameron Health (US), LivaNova (GB), Philips (NL)

    Atrial Fibrillation (Dominant) vs. Unexplained Falls (Emerging)

    Atrial Fibrillation is the dominant force within the Implantable Cardiac Monitors Market, characterized by its widespread prevalence and substantial clinical focus. As a key indication, it frequently necessitates continuous monitoring due to its association with serious health complications. In contrast, Unexplained Falls emerges as a notable focus area, particularly among elderly populations who are prone to sudden episodes. Although less recognized than atrial fibrillation, the medical community is increasingly directing attention toward unexplained falls as they can indicate underlying cardiac issues. Advancements in monitoring technology enable the detection of arrhythmias that could lead to falls, creating a dual benefit of enhancing patient safety while driving innovation in device utility.

    North America : Market Leader in Innovation

    North America is the largest market for implantable cardiac monitors, accounting for approximately 45% of the global market share. The region's growth is driven by increasing prevalence of cardiovascular diseases, technological advancements, and supportive regulatory frameworks. The demand for remote monitoring solutions is also rising, fueled by the aging population and a shift towards value-based healthcare. The United States is the primary contributor, with key players like Medtronic, Abbott, and Boston Scientific leading the market. The competitive landscape is characterized by continuous innovation and strategic partnerships. The presence of advanced healthcare infrastructure further enhances market growth, making North America a hub for cardiac monitoring technologies.

    Europe : Emerging Regulatory Frameworks

    Europe is the second-largest market for implantable cardiac monitors, holding around 30% of the global market share. The region's growth is propelled by increasing awareness of cardiac health, advancements in technology, and supportive regulatory frameworks. The European Union's Medical Device Regulation (MDR) has also catalyzed innovation, ensuring safety and efficacy in medical devices. Leading countries include Germany, France, and the UK, where major players like Biotronik and Philips are actively involved. The competitive landscape is marked by a focus on research and development, with companies striving to meet stringent regulatory standards. The presence of a robust healthcare system and increasing investment in healthcare technology further support market expansion.

    August 2022: Merit Medical Systems, Inc. unveiled the SafeGuard Focus Cool Compression Device, an innovative addition to its SafeGuard platform. This device complements a broader cardiac portfolio, which encompasses tools and accessories essential for interventional cardiac resynchronization therapy, electrophysiology, and cardiac rhythm management.

    April 2023: Honeywell has introduced a real-time health monitoring system capable of capturing and recording patients' vital signs in both hospital and remote settings. The system employs advanced sensing technology integrated into a skin patch to monitor vital signs. This data is instantly transmitted to healthcare providers via mobile devices and an online dashboard, ensuring prompt and efficient monitoring and response.
